多重硫腐蝕對變壓器油紙復合絕緣劣化的影響機制研究

  本文選題:變壓器 + 油紙絕緣。 參考:《華北電力大學(北京)》2017年碩士論文


【摘要】:電力變壓器是電網(wǎng)系統(tǒng)中最重要的設備之一,其正常運行是電力系統(tǒng)安全、可靠及經(jīng)濟運行的重要保證。油浸式變壓器是輸配電設備中最常用的變壓器,也是最重要和最為核心的設備之一,對保證電網(wǎng)安全運行具有重大意義。變壓器油中存在的活性較強的硫化物與銅導線反應生成銅的硫化物,沉積在絕緣紙表面,降低絕緣紙電氣性能,引發(fā)絕緣故障。目前國內(nèi)外許多研究認為,二芐基二硫(Benzyl Disulfide,以下簡稱DBDS)是變壓器絕緣油中主要的腐蝕性硫成分,此外變壓器油中還含有其他多種硫成分,如硫醇、砜類、硫醚等化合物,多種硫成分的交互作用也會對變壓器油紙絕緣產(chǎn)生影響作用,因此,研究多重硫腐蝕對油紙絕緣系統(tǒng)的劣化作用機理具有重要的學術價值。為研究多種腐蝕性硫化物對油紙絕緣系統(tǒng)老化特性的影響規(guī)律,本文對含有不同濃度DBDS和二芐基硫醚以及十二硫醇的油紙絕緣系統(tǒng)在140℃環(huán)境下開展加速熱老化試驗,定期取樣,并對絕緣紙聚合度、油紙中酸值和水分等特征參量進行測量分析。研究表明:腐蝕性硫化物加速了油紙絕緣系統(tǒng)的老化程度;紙中酸值和油中微水含量的波動幅度、絕緣紙裂解速率、油中糠醛含量均隨DBDS和十二硫醇濃度增大而增大;油中多種腐蝕性硫化物對油紙絕緣系統(tǒng)老化的聯(lián)合作用不等于單一硫化物的線性疊加,表明油中多種腐蝕性硫化物對油紙絕緣系統(tǒng)的影響存在交互作用。為研究外界環(huán)境條件對多重硫腐蝕反應的影響,本文對含有不同濃度DBDS和十六硫醇以及十八硫醇的油紙絕緣系統(tǒng)在130℃環(huán)境下開展加速熱老化試驗,并設定溫度及氧氣對照,定期取樣進行測試。研究表明:氧氣濃度不同時,在多重硫腐蝕作用下,油紙絕緣老化特性變化有一定差異;硫腐蝕對老化程度的影響整體上隨溫度升高而增加;同時含有兩種硫化物時,十六硫醇與十八硫醇協(xié)同作用對銅片腐蝕的促進作用較弱。為研究腐蝕性絕緣油中硫化物的種類和含量,本文基于氣相色譜儀和硫化學發(fā)光檢測器聯(lián)合分析技術,建立了一種變壓器油中多重硫化物定性與定量分析的方法;利用該分析方法,研究了不同類型硫醇在變壓器油中的腐蝕作用。分析結果表明當變壓器油中僅含一種硫醇時,老化僅生成相應硫醚;而當變壓器油中含有多種硫醇時,不同硫醇會發(fā)生交聯(lián)反應,生成新的硫醚。
[Abstract]:Power transformer is one of the most important equipments in power system, and its normal operation is an important guarantee for safe, reliable and economical operation of power system. Oil-immersed transformer is the most commonly used transformer in transmission and distribution equipment, and it is also one of the most important and core equipment. It is of great significance to ensure the safe operation of power grid. The active sulfide in transformer oil reacts with copper wire to form copper sulfide, which deposits on the surface of insulator paper, reduces the electrical performance of insulator paper, and causes insulation failure. At present, many studies at home and abroad believe that Benzyl Disulfide (hereinafter referred to as DBDS) is the main corrosive sulfur component in transformer insulating oil, in addition, transformer oil also contains a variety of other sulfur components, such as mercaptan, sulfone, sulfide and so on. The interaction of various sulfur components will also affect the oil-paper insulation of transformers. Therefore, it is of great academic value to study the mechanism of degradation of oil-paper insulation system caused by multi-sulfur corrosion.
